
A deadly incident on the rails shook the community of San Diego this weekend. According to The San Diego County Sheriff's Office, a North County Transit District Coaster train struck and killed a man last Friday night near Moreno Boulevard. The victim, whose identity remains unreleased pending family notification by the Medical Examiner's Office, succumbed to his injuries on the scene.
The collision reported at approximately 10:25 pm, prompted a swift response from local law enforcement and fire departments. The Sheriff's Transit Enforcement Unit (TEU) is now leading the investigation into the accident, as they typically handle incidents associated with the transit routes of the North County Transit District. The TEU is looking into the circumstances that led to the tragic event, and an autopsy will establish the official cause and manner of death.
